The New Reality: Brand Identity Is Built Daily, Not Occasionally


A strong brand identity is not created in one campaign—it’s built through consistent, repeated interactions across every touchpoint. Social media posts, email newsletters, website updates, customer responses, and content marketing all shape how your audience perceives you.


Yet most businesses struggle with consistency. Why? Because branding execution is time-intensive.

Virtual assistants solve this gap.


With over 40 million virtual assistants globally in 2025, businesses now have access to a highly skilled, distributed workforce capable of executing brand-building activities at scale. Nearly 60% of VAs are college-educated, many specializing in marketing, branding, and digital strategy.


This means you’re no longer hiring “help”. You are hiring your brand operators.


Consistency = Trust: The #1 Driver of Brand Strength


Consistency is the backbone of brand identity. Brands that show up regularly are perceived as more credible, reliable, and professional.


Virtual assistants ensure:

  • Daily social media posting
  • Timely customer responses
  • Consistent brand voice across platforms
  • Scheduled content calendars


And the results are measurable. Businesses using VAs for marketing execution have seen social media engagement increase by up to 340%.


That’s not just visibility—that’s brand amplification.


Cost Efficiency That Fuels Brand Growth


Hiring in-house teams to manage branding can be expensive and slow. Salaries, benefits, office space, and training all add up quickly.


Virtual assistants change the equation.


Businesses can reduce labor and operational costs by up to 78% by hiring virtual assistants instead of full-time staff. This allows companies to reinvest those savings into high-impact branding initiatives like:

  • Paid advertising
  • Content production
  • Brand strategy development


In short, VAs don’t just save money, they create budget for growth.

Specialized Skills That Strengthen Brand Identity


Modern virtual assistants are no longer limited to admin tasks. Today’s VAs specialize in:

  • Social media management
  • SEO optimization
  • Graphic design
  • Email marketing
  • Website management


In fact, industries like marketing, real estate, and IT are among the top adopters of virtual assistants in 2026, accounting for a significant share of global demand.


This specialization allows businesses to build a cohesive and professional brand presence without hiring multiple full-time experts.
